When it is correct how can I return the corresponding Filter a data-attribute and return the corresponding id in an array. Example. The attr() method sets or returns attributes and values of the selected elements. The array is a data structure that can hold one or more values in a single variable. Alternatively, you can also use the jQuery data () method (jQuery version >= 1.4.3), to get the data-attribute of an element using the syntax like $ (element).data (key). java by Grepper on Oct 23 2019 Donate . What that Ajax call is is not important. How to check if an element has a class in jQuery? Feel free to ask questions about the code, and let me know if there are problems. Syntax $("[attribute^='value']") Parameter Description; attribute: Required. However, jQuery provides a much lighter alternative for the same purpose. Many methods are available in jQuery for the modifications of these attributes. pass all checked checkboxes values, selected values from the list. - gist:4266921 How to clone an element using jQuery? < script > /* Access the attribute data-content1 from element with id c1 $('#c1').attr('data-content1') and write the value into the div. Using the jQuery data attr() method, you can get and set data attribute values easily from selected html elements. Selected Reading; UPSC IAS Exams Notes; Developer's Best Practices; Questions and Answers ; Effective Resume Writing; HR Interview Questions; Computer Glossary; Who is Who; How to find an … And there is an HTML5 data attribute getting function also in JQuery data() that retrieves all data element values. var cars = ["Saab", … How do I check if an element is hidden in jQuery? I guess you mean the data-value value should contain all the key/values for every 'field' I want searchable, so: data-value='{"name:a","status:b","location:c","department:d","title:e"}' and so on. How to select elements by data attribute using CSS? Setting multiple attributes with jQuery. For get an attribute’s value use the below syntax $(selector).attr(attribute); Using the below syntax you can set an … This selector selects elements that have the value exactly equal to the specified value. You can change the attributes in the way you want once you get access to those properties. joe, jill but not john) and where the data-label=date element has data-value of the entered date. Answer: Use the CSS Attribute Selector. How to get and set data attribute values. + "']" ).data( "value" ).toLowerCase().indexOf( ??? ) Specifies the … JavaScript Arrays Previous Next JavaScript arrays are used to store multiple values in a single variable. Example: Below is the implementation of above approach. Call the plugin and put your array in plugin’s data option. :\b(and|or)\b)?/g; $( ".content .tile" ).filter( function() {. Other than that, you can try to run the following code to learn how to use jQuery selectors on custom data attributes using HTML5: This method can be used to get the form data. jQuery DataTables only supports COLSPAN or ROWSPAN attributes in table header as long as you have at least one header cell per column. Syntax. Note that .removeData() will only remove data from jQuery's internal .data() cache, and any corresponding data-attributes on the element will not be removed. For get an attribute’s value use the below syntax it doesnt work for me. How to append an element before an element using jQuery? Just name your file elements the same and end the name in brackets: jQuery.each(jQuery('#file')[0].files, function(i, file) { data.append('file[]', file); }); $_FILES['file'] will then be an array containing the … The jQuery attr() method is used to get or set attributes and values of the selected html elements. In this tutorial, I show how you can pass JavaScript Array to an AJAX request with an example. To prevent this, use .removeAttr() alongside .removeData() to remove the data-attribute as well. From the server and place the returned html into the matched element. `` [ attribute^='value ' ] '' Parameter! 50 simple variables: var myvar1 ; var myvar2 ; and so on the attribute... On element in Selenium var myvar2 ; and so on required for each display returned an! Jquery set data attribute values the characters you see in the picture below [, fromIndex ] ) value methods... Returns 0 index of the entered criteria to select an element using jQuery + $ ( `` [ attribute^='value ]. Product 2 ( value, it sets one or more attribute/value pairs the!, it returns all the value from the server and place the returned into! States in our jQuery program in a URL query string or Ajax request show how can. For certain elements based on a data-attribute value using jQuery is quite easy.find ( `` value '' ) (. Can set the data change the attributes in table header as long as you them. In plugin ’ s data option why you want to store 50 us States in our jQuery program a. Which to begin the search need and, the li attribute is bad need. The array at which to begin the search: //regex101.com/r/mGdwOQ/1 ) a....: joe, jill,! john and date: xx/yy/zz their parent using CSS library a... I will be focusing on array data of jQuery is quite easy the default is 0 which... [ name ], version added: 1.2 jQuery.inArray ( value, $.inArray )! Therefore re-retrieve the value of the names ( i.e header cell per column say the JSON data first! Using Selenium WebDriver you have at least one header cell per column identical to attrsasclasses, except attributes will jQuery! Want to store multiple values in both cases, your jQuery code uses the array is?... Attribute values easily from selected html elements an asynchronous HTTP ( Ajax ).! Of data ( ).indexOf (?????? double quotes the! Re-Retrieve the value of an element based on a data-attribute ) by serializing form values height their! In the way you want once you get access to those properties methods for changing and manipulating html and... Jquery code uses the array is a highly customizable and feature-rich library that can be used to return the filter. In PHP jQuery DataTable is a highly customizable and feature-rich library that can hold one or attribute/value... One jquery data attribute array more attribute/value pairs for the set of matched elements can set data! Within an array \b )? /g ; $ ( ' # c1 '.! And attributes function ( ) to remove the data-attribute as well data ( ordering, searching, etc demonstrates you! ) Perform an asynchronous HTTP ( Ajax ) request search the whole.... ) to look for multiple values in a single variable Grepper Chrome Extension inputs fields results for: get from. Div for to match a data-attribute and return the corresponding filter a and. See here: https: //regex101.com/r/mGdwOQ/1 ) how can I use.filter ( function ( Create! Key in PHP jQuery for the set of matched elements made for every table,! Found ) of the selected html elements and attributes ) and will return all the... In your cityList, jquery data attribute array some random value value, it returns all value! After searching through many solutions I decided to blog about how to actually render array to data... Of the array variable name to access and manipulate elements and attributes able to get or attributes. Are collected from stackoverflow, are licensed under Creative Commons Attribution-ShareAlike license.indexOf (?? matched! It would be reading jquery data attribute array JSON data looks like this: jQuery, jsp,,. A time, or as a set: 1 2019 Donate Definition and.! Below is the implementation of above approach # 2: jQuery data ( ) method div to... 50 us States in our jQuery program in a single element one at time... Can change the attributes that has prefix like data- * attributes are the most common types to interact.... Attribute and value are mandatory it would be MUCH easier if you want you! `` [ attribute^='value ' ] '' ) here, attribute and value are.. Make it easy to access and manipulate elements and the results would change to show any '... Multiple attributes with jQuery % height of their parent using CSS it returns the retrieved data the! At a time, or as a set: 1 one at a time, or as a set 1... You have at least one header cell per column more attribute/value pairs for the set of elements... Preset the value attribute as suggested by @ Choatech: value false false string `` the... Is it possible to do the job of decoding it into a object. Grepper Chrome Extension an issue beginning in a variable as a set: 1 (! Selectors provide a very powerful way to select elements by their data attribute to about... Did not use data- attributes, this was not an issue set value in?... Attribute and value ) by serializing form values DataTables only supports COLSPAN or ROWSPAN attributes in table header long... Allows the user to manipulate html elements any of the first matched element popular and less time-consuming ones index an! Data html attribute all checked checkboxes values, it returns all the value of names! Or data-filter=5 looks like this: jQuery data ( ) to look multiple! From your google search results for: get data to attribute values it. These attributes of the object check if an element after an element has of... You have at least one header cell per column required for each returned... Jill but not john ) and where the data-label=date element has data-value of the names ( i.e retrieve several values. Description ; attribute: required to you how you can get and set data attribute values using the attr )... We can do is to Create 50 simple variables: var myvar1 var! With JSON version 1.4.3, jQuery ’ s data ( ) Perform an asynchronous HTTP Ajax... Attributes and values of the object `` value '' instantly right from your google search results with the of... The job of decoding it into a JavaScript object - no complicated regex needed, except attributes will become data... ) did not use data- attributes, this was not an issue a. In Selenium: jQuery, jsp, struts2, struts2-jquery, struts2-jquery-plugin get code examples like `` jQuery set attribute. Teach you how to delete an array is a highly customizable and feature-rich library that can be used to the... Prefix like data- * attributes are supported through.data ( ) method, can. Specified, however, should be one of the names ( i.e to attribute values to... To filter elements by data attribute jQuery ” code Answer every table redraw, with a specific string there. Use in a single variable provides a simple API and a lot of options... Css attribute selectors to find the index of the html elements below options to login first element the. Access and manipulate elements and attributes use ROWSPAN attribute with RowsGroup plugin, … JavaScript Parsing # 2 jQuery. ‘ jQuery selector ’ allows the user to manipulate html elements jQuery,... Data structure that can hold one or more values in both the data-label and data-value?... Use jQuery to filter elements by their data attribute values easily from selected html elements every table redraw with. Would use a JSON string is that somebody can type in: name: joe jill! Value 5 ) you can get and set data attribute value from html input using... Would be MUCH easier if you want once you get access to jquery data attribute array.... Using regex ( see here: https: //regex101.com/r/mGdwOQ/1 ) however, should be one the...: Number selected values from the server and place the returned html into the matched element we explain. Previously set on html elements and attributes then use the CSS attribute selectors to find the index of the elements...: ' + $ ( ' # myimage ' ) a serialized of! Next JavaScript Arrays are used to return the corresponding filter a data-attribute value using jQuery quite! Alongside.removeData ( ) Perform an asynchronous HTTP ( Ajax ) request to those properties a variable like. Those are the most common types to interact with their data attribute values can hold one more... A highly customizable and feature-rich library that can hold one or more values in a single variable key for! Of objects ( name and value ) by serializing form values specific string to removes data attribute using CSS.removeAttr. ] example: the answers/resolutions are collected from stackoverflow, are licensed under Creative Commons license. Can I return the attribute value from html elements I decided to blog how... As inappropriate at a time, or as a set: 1 re-retrieve the value of first. Should be one of the data- attribute inside an object as key-value pairs: $ ``... Part of jQuery is quite easy data-label= ' '' +?? array which. Plugin, … JavaScript Parsing # 2: jQuery data attr ( ) and will return of. About how to find an element using Selenium WebDriver select Product 2 ( 5... From stackoverflow, are licensed under Creative Commons Attribution-ShareAlike license for jquery data attribute array the set of elements! Can used to return the attribute value, array [, fromIndex ] )....